Research Paper- MLA
Informative Project Research MLA Paper
Research the approved topic. Submit one 5-7 page typed paper, double spaced, 11 point font following MLA guidelines. Include a bibliography citing at least 7 resources used researching the paper. Paper will be graded on quality of research to support the topic, effective use of information gained through research, credibility of sources, content, grammar and mechanics, and bibliography.

Clarity/formatting
5 pts
Excellent
5pts<BR>
--Paper is at least 4 full pages in length<BR>
--Title page is properly formatted<BR>
--double spaced<BR>
--12 pt., Times New Roman<BR>
--1" margins
Good
4 pts<BR>
--Paper is at least 3 pages in length<BR>
--Title page is properly formatted<BR>
--double spaced<BR>
--12 pt., Times New Roman<BR>
--1" margins
Fair
3 pts<BR>
--Paper is at least 2 pages in length<BR>
--Title page is close to the proper format<BR>
-- font and margins partially correct
Poor
2 pt<BR>
--Paper is less than 1 pages in length<BR>
--Title page is missing<BR>
--font and margins not correct
Content
35 pts
Excellent
30 pts<BR>
--Thesis is clear, interesting, and arguable<BR>
--Topic interesting, of appropriate breadth for length of paper & an appropriate topic for research.<BR>
--Support for thesis complex, complete, & in-depth.<BR>
--Clear and appropriate organization, with effective transitions, introduction, and conclusion.<BR>
--All information is analyzed thoughtfully, not just summarized
Good
20 pts<BR>
--Thesis is clear, but basic<BR>
--Topic somewhat broad or narrow for length of paper and/or a questionable topic for research.<BR>
--Support for thesis sufficient, but lacking in depth or complexity.<BR>
--Organization, transitions, introduction, and conclusion slightly lacking clarity and/or appropriateness.<BR>
--Most information is analyzed, some just summarized
Fair
10 pts<BR>
--Thesis is somewhat clear<BR>
--Topic too broad or narrow for length of paper and/or a poor topic for research.<BR>
--Support for thesis barely sufficient, and/or.<BR>
--Organization, transitions, introduction, and conclusion lacking clarity and/or appropriateness.<BR>
--Some information is analyzed, much is just summarized
Poor
2 pts<BR>
--Topic too broad or narrow for length of paper and/or a poor topic for research.<BR>
--Support for thesis barely sufficient.<BR>
--Organization, transitions, introduction, and conclusion lacking clarity and/or appropriateness.<BR>
--Information is merely stated or summarized
